About us

S & S Lawn services Inc is a licensed and insured lawn service which was founded in December 1987 as a part time business. Through hard work and dedication to the customer the owner/manager has transformed the company from a small operation into a well established business in the Northern Virginia community. We are committed to maintaining the standard of quality which has helped S&S to grow over the years.

My first service experience began with 2 no shows.  My contract was suppose to begin with a service 4 (core aeration, reseed,

fertilization, broadleaf control Sep 2012.  After 2 no shows it was November 2012 when they wanted to aerate and reseed.  Versus cancelling we agreed to make the contract start with first service in 2013.
First service after I called to complain and ask where they were, was April 2013.  Late for Virginia to be getting the best out of pre-emergent weed control.  My very well maintained lawn (thanks to TruGreen prior season) now looked liked a forest.  After two weeks the product didn't make a dent even in the dandelions.  I saw no evidence of any weed wilting.  I finally hand weeded the major weeds out of my 11,500 foot of lawn thinking this might help the 2nd service get ahead of the problem. I also had to resolve a billing mix-up as they started to claim my first service was actually my second.  I did get resolution on my third phone call.
Second service early summer was fertilization, pre-emergence, broadleaf control and grub proofing.  They finally showed up 24 May for this.  My bigger frustration was I noticed red thread developing and asked for someone to come out and confirm and treat.  I even offered to pay extra.  Bottom line is they kept promising and never showed to even evaluate until the second service.
Between 2nd service and 3rd weeds did not appear to be impacted at all.  I asked for a re-inspection and retreatment .  Promise after promise no one showed.  As a test I went to Home Depot and bought some over the counter Bayer lawn weed spray.  I sprayed many of the troubled areas and saw visible weed wilting within 8 hours just like the product advertised.  Basically, whatever S&S was putting down was so watered down or sparse, it couldn't even compete with a Home Depot product.
Just after the 3rd service, 20 July, Post Emergence, Insect control, Fungus control. I asked if they were going to treat at least the visible areas of the Red Thread again and complained again about no visible impact on the weed control.  They have never come back out to even look at anything and it is now 19 Sep and getting late for the core aeration and reseeding.
Bottom line, I had to go to southern States and buy a commercial product which I used twice with a two week spacing and I now seem to have gotten the upper hand.  My lawn has only survived the S&S Lawn Experience thanks to Southern States and Home depot commercial products which I did the labor to apply.
I've asked to speak to someone in Management at S&S but no one is ever apparently there and no one has ever returned a call.
From what I can tell, they either skimped, watered down, or used inferior products.  I had to supplement everything.  Weed control  Insect control, Grub control, and Fungus control and apply myself.
In prepping for 2014, I had another company evaluate which soil tested several areas.  Their tests showed the yard was under-fertilized.  Another confirmation of product or service deficiency.
I am going back to TruGreen for 2014.  Their product works and they retreat as promised.  Do not be fooled by S&S Lawn Services comprehensive list of services performed.  Not one is of quality
to warrant the expense.  Better to do yourself.
